at_cur Displays the current network start, network end, and
default zone for all AppleTalk interfaces.
at_it Displays the status of all AppleTalk interfaces.
at_rt Displays the entries in the routing table, including the
node and network IDs of the next hops in the network,
the number of hops, and the status of the network.
at_zones Lists the zones in the router’s zone table.
at_arp Lists the AARP entries in the router’s address mapping
table.
/jointfilesconvert/100949/bgpenabled Displays the state of all configured BGP connections.
Valid values are
1 = Enabled
2 = Disabled
/jointfilesconvert/100949/bgppeers Displays the BGP IDs (for the connections that are
established) of all BGP peers.
/jointfilesconvert/100949/bgppeerstate Displays the administrative state of all configured BGP
connections. Valid values are
1 = Up
2 = Down
3 = Init
4 = Invalid
5 = NotPresent
/jointfilesconvert/100949/bgpconnstate Displays the
BGP FSM
state of all configured BGP
connections. Valid values are
1 = Idle
2 = Connect
3 = Active
4 = OpenSent
5 = OpenConfirm
6 = Established
/jointfilesconvert/100949/bgp3origin Displays the
ORIGIN
attribute of each network
advertisement received via BGP-3. Valid values are
1 = IGP
2 = EGP
3 = Incomplete
/jointfilesconvert/100949/bgp3aspath Displays the
AS_PATH
attribute of each network
advertisement received via BGP-3.
/jointfilesconvert/100949/bgp3nexthop Displays the
NEXT_HOP
attribute of each network
advertisement received via BGP-3.
